Investigation on Carbon Fiber Microelectrodes (Ⅴ)--The Kinetics of Ferrocene and Its Derivatives on Carbon Fiber Ultramicroelectrodes

Abstract: The present paper reports the voltammetric behaviour of ferrocene and its five derivatives in various organic solvents, as well as the effects of scan rate of potential and supporting electrolyte on the currents investigated with both caron fiber ultramicroelectrode of radius 5 μm and glassy carbon electrode for comparison. The diffusion coefficients, electron transfer rate constants and half-wave potentials of the six compounds in different solvents were determined. The experimental results for the ferrocene in acetonitrile are in good agreement with those from literatures, but the most other data presented in this paper have not been reported yet in literatures.
